Australian food ingredients manufacturer Burns Philp & Co Ltd revealed today that its future prospects are positive after posting a 7.7% rise in net profit to A$88.5m (US$46.36m) for the 2000/01 year to June 30, 2001.

Revenue during the same period also increased to A$1.44bn, signifying an increase of 11.3%.
The Sydney-based firm did not declare a final dividend.
